The tariff classification of footwear from China
Issued June 30, 1999 by U.S. Customs and Border Protection.
Tariff classification
HTS codes: 6401.99.3000
Headings: 6401
Product description
The submitted half pair sample is a below-the-ankle height waterproof, slip-on rain shoe, identified as style name “Lucy-Moc Toe-0216-2A”. It has an all rubber upper, the component parts of which have been assembled and formed by molding and vulcanization processes, and a separately vulcanized-on, coarsely molded rubber outer sole. This low-top rain shoe also has a removable, textile faced, rubber/plastic insole and a thin textile fabric lining. The shoe is designed to keep the wearer’s feet dry and has no closures.
CBP rationale
The applicable subheading for the rain shoe described above, will be 6401.99.3000,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for waterproof footwear with outer soles and uppers of rubber or plastics, the uppers of which are neither fixed to the sole nor assembled by stitching, riveting, nailing, screwing, plugging or similar processes; which does not cover the ankle; which does not contain a protective metal toe-cap; which is designed to be a protection against water, oil, grease or chemicals or cold or inclement weather; and which is designed to be used without closures.

The rate of duty will be 25% ad valorem.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177).
